小编mih*_*k3l的帖子

删除列中的非数字字符(charachter vary),postgresql(9.3.5)

我需要删除列中的非数字字符(字符变化)并在postgresql 9.3.5中保留数值.

例子:

1) "ggg" => ""
2) "3,0 kg" => "3,0"
3) "15 kg." => "15"
4) ...
Run Code Online (Sandbox Code Playgroud)

有一些问题,有些值如下:

1) "2x3,25" 
2) "96+109" 
3) ...
Run Code Online (Sandbox Code Playgroud)

这些需要保持原样(即在数字字符之间包含非数字字符时 - 什么都不做).

有任何想法吗?

postgresql

7
推荐指数
2
解决办法
2万
查看次数

标签 统计

postgresql ×1